To use a British Airways promo code, start by visiting britishairways.com and selecting your desired flights by entering your departure and destination cities along with travel dates. After choosing your preferred flights and fare type, proceed to the passenger details page where you'll enter traveler information. On the payment page, look for the "Promotional code" or "Voucher code" field typically located above the payment method section. Paste your discount code into this field and click "Apply" to see the savings reflected in your total fare.
If your promo code isn't working, first verify that it hasn't expired and check any minimum spending requirements or route restrictions that may apply. Some codes are only valid for specific destinations, cabin classes, or booking periods. Additionally, certain promotional fares or already discounted tickets may not be eligible for further coupon discounts. Try clearing your browser cache or using a different valid code from our collection if the issue persists.
British Airways typically launches major sales during key booking periods throughout the year. The New Year travel sale in January often features some of the best discounts, with savings of up to 30% on long-haul flights as travelers plan their annual vacations. Spring brings promotional fares for summer travel season, usually starting in February and March, when you can find deals on popular European and North American routes with discounts ranging from 15-25% off regular fares.
Black Friday and Cyber Monday in November present excellent opportunities for significant flight savings, with British Airways frequently offering flash sales and limited-time promotional codes. Summer booking season from May through June also sees competitive pricing as the airline promotes off-peak travel periods, particularly for autumn and winter destinations with potential savings of 20% or more on select routes.
Book your British Airways flights 6-8 weeks in advance for optimal pricing, as this sweet spot typically offers the best balance between availability and fare costs. Take advantage of the airline's flexible date search feature on their website, which displays fare calendars showing price variations across different departure and return dates - sometimes shifting your travel by just a day or two can result in substantial savings of £50-200 per ticket.
Maximize your savings by joining the British Airways Executive Club loyalty program, which allows you to earn Avios points on flights that can be redeemed for future travel discounts or upgrades. Additionally, consider booking connecting flights instead of direct routes when time permits, as these often come with significantly lower fares. Stack your savings by using a travel rewards credit card for your British Airways purchase to earn additional points while applying promotional codes for immediate discounts.
British Airways stands as one of the world's leading airlines, connecting travelers to over 200 destinations across six continents. The carrier offers a comprehensive range of services including international and domestic flights, with cabin options from World Traveller economy to luxurious First Class suites.
Beyond flights, British Airways provides complete travel solutions through their website. Customers can book hotels, arrange car rentals, and purchase travel insurance to create seamless trip experiences. The airline's holiday packages combine flights and accommodations for popular destinations, simplifying vacation planning.
The Executive Club loyalty program rewards frequent flyers with Avios points, which can be redeemed for flight upgrades, free tickets, and partner rewards. Members enjoy priority boarding, lounge access, and extra baggage allowances based on their tier status.
